Wyndham Announces Exclusive Partnership With Business and Professional Women/USA
Business Wire, Sept 30, 1999
DALLAS--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Sept. 30, 1999--
Wyndham To Become Official Hotel Company
of Prestigious National Women's Organization
Wyndham Hotels & Resorts, a division of Wyndham International (NYSE:WYN), will become the official hotel company for Business and Professional Women/USA (BPW/USA).
"This new partnership is a natural progression of Wyndham's long-term commitment to women business travelers and the evolution of our 'Women on Their Way' program," said Les Bentley, president, Wyndham Hotels & Resorts. "We support BPW/USA's goal to promote equality for all women in the workplace and believe our affiliation will be mutually beneficial," he added.
Wyndham's initial 18-month partnership with Business and Professional Women/USA will include:
-- special negotiated rates (beginning Jan. 15, 2000) that provide a
significant member discount at any Wyndham;
-- a donation directly to the BPW Foundation Scholarship Fund,
enabling low income working women to complete their undergraduate
and graduate education so they can achieve career advancement,
greater equity in today's work force and financial
self-sufficiency;
-- in-kind Wyndham room nights for BPW/USA events;
-- allocation of funds allowing 25 Wyndham employees to become
BPW/USA members;
-- BPW/USA representation on the Wyndham "Women on Their Way"
Advisory Board, a panel of frequent women business travelers who
advise Wyndham on the development and evaluation of new products
and programs designed to appeal to the growing group of women
traveling on business.
In addition, Wyndham will feature BPW/USA information on their Web site for women business travelers, www.womenontheirway.com, and BPW/USA members will be among the first to take advantage of Wyndham's promotional offers and packages announced on the site throughout the year.
"Women business travelers are not only looking for a hotel company that offers the products and services they desire, but one that recognizes the challenges facing them in their professional and personal lives," said Cary Jehl Broussard, director of Wyndham's "Women on Their Way" program. "Wyndham continually seeks out strategic partnerships and opportunities that will enhance both women's business travel experiences and their positions in today's competitive workplace."
Other organizations that are supported by Wyndham's "Women on Their Way" program include the National Association of Women Business Owners (NAWBO) and the Susan G. Komen Foundation. Wyndham is the national hotel partner for each of these organizations.
Wyndham's "Women On Their Way" program is a distinctive, award-winning initiative designed to serve women business travelers by constantly staying in touch with them and evolving to meet their changing needs. Over the years, the program has achieved a number of milestones, including the development of an advisory board, a research arrangement with New York University and an innovative Web site (www.womenontheirway.com) -- all designed to elicit feedback from women business travelers. Other accomplishments include in-room amenity upgrades, in-room dining enhancements and the growing number of strategic partnerships with women advocacy groups.
Business and Professional Women/USA, founded in 1919, promotes equity for all women in the workplace through advocacy, education and information. With 70,000 members in more than 2,000 local organizations represented in every congressional district in the country, BPW/USA includes among its members women and men of every age, race, religion, political party and socio-economic background. BPW/USA also monitors federal legislation that affects working women and educates its members to become involved in public policy development in their own workplaces and at the local, state, and federal government levels.
Wyndham International, Inc. ranks among the largest branded hotel companies in the United States. It owns, leases, manages and franchises primarily upscale and luxury hotels and resorts representing a combined portfolio of 317 hotels and resorts with a total of more than 74,000 rooms in 38 states as well as Canada, the Caribbean and Europe.
